Comfort

In the world of mattresses, two types of products stand out as offering the best levels of comfort - orthopedic memory foam mattress double foam and pocket sprung. Although they may appear to be similar, there are several important distinctions between them. The major differences between the two mattresses are the type of support, the feeling they provide while sleeping, and the amount of movement they can absorb.

A memory foam mattress uses temperature-sensitive, high-density visco-elastic foam that moulds to your body shape and weight to offer exceptional support and pressure relief. It also distributes your body weight evenly to reduce joint pressure. This mattress is ideal for people with back pain or poor circulation, as well as those who participate in a lot of in sports. It also helps relieve minor pains and discomforts that can cause you move around throughout the night, promoting a more restful and a deeper sleep.

Another important distinction is that memory foam mattresses have excellent motion separation, which means you won't be able to feel your partner's movements during the night. This is due to the fact the foam is shaped to fit your body's shape and weight so that it absorbs the vibrations of your partner's movement.

A pocket spring mattress can also provide great motion separation, but not as much as a memory foam mattress. The pockets in a pocket spring bed let each spring respond to your weight, rather than shaking the entire bed.

Pocket-sprung mattresses are firm, which is great for those who prefer a firm mattress. They are more suited to those who have heavier frames as springs offer more support. If you're a side-sleeper, a memory mattress is ideal because it can conform to your body shape and support joints.

A hybrid mattress is an excellent option if you're not able to decide between a memory foam mattress and a pocket spring mattress. This combines the benefits of both and is available from brands such as Simba Sleep. This mattress has an additional layer of memory foam that conforms to your body and enhances the support provided by the pocket springs, and a pocket-sprung base layer.
